Teaching till 80 years ..

As a 58-year-old professor teaching operations management in India, I can consider the following steps to continue teaching till 80 years old:

  1. Maintaining good health: Taking care of one's physical and mental health is important to ensure one is able to continue teaching for a longer period. This includes regular exercise, eating a balanced diet, getting enough sleep, and managing stress.

  2. Staying up to date: Keep oneself updated with the latest developments in the field of operations management. Attend conferences, workshops, and seminars, and engage in ongoing professional development to maintain expertise and relevance.

  3. Adapting to changing technology: Embrace technology and incorporate it into one's teaching to keep up with the times and remain relevant to students. This may include using online platforms for teaching, virtual simulations, and other digital tools.

  4. Networking: Maintaining strong connections with colleagues, alumni, and other professionals in one's field can help to stay informed about the latest developments, as well as provide opportunities for professional growth.

  5. Taking breaks: It's important to take breaks and recharge to prevent burnout and maintain one's energy levels. Consider taking regular vacations, engaging in hobbies, and spending time with loved ones to refresh and rejuvenate.

Note: It's important to consult with one's doctor regularly to monitor  health and ensure one is capable of continuing to teach. It's also good to have a contingency plan in case of any health issues or unexpected events
